Cristina Cornaro obtained the Laurea degree in Physics (cum laude) from La Sapienza University, Rome, Italy in 1991, and the Ph.D. from the Tor Vergata University, Rome, in 1996. She spent almost one year in research on thermo-fluid-dynamics processes at the University of Minneapolis, Minnesota, USA, and two years as a Post-Doc at the Tor Vergata University.
Since 2001 she has been a research assistant with the Department of Enterprise Engineering of the Tor Vergata University.
She is teaching Environmental Applied Physics for the Tor Vergata Engineering courses and Certification, Measurements and Monitoring Systems for the second-level Master in Photovoltaic Engineering at the same University.

Her research activity concerns thermo-fluid-dynamics processes, comfort and indoor air quality, environmental measurements and solar energy conversion.
She manages the environmental applied physics laboratory and, since 2003, the weather and solar station of the Tor Vergata University. Since 2007 she is also managing the ESTER facility, consisting of the solar and weather unit and of a PV module monitoring unit. Her interests have recently focused onto weather and solar radiation measurements at ground for performance evaluation of photovoltaic systems and monitoring and test of solar conversion devices of various technologies.

Prof. Cornaro is author/co-author of almost 40 scientific publications in international journals, conferences and books
